三菱PLC称重重量累加程序详解摘要:该程序主要用于实现称重系统中重量的累加功能。通过三菱PLC的编程,可以读取称重传感器的数据,并将其转换为实际的重量值。程序会不断累加每次读取的重量值,并在达到预设条件或触发事件时,进行累加结果的输出或存储。该程序具有高精度、高可靠性和易于维护等优点,广泛应用于工业自动化和物流管理等领域,提高了生产效率和准确性。
本文目录导读:
本文旨在详细介绍如何使用三菱PLC(可编程逻辑控制器)编写称重重量累加程序,通过逐步解析程序逻辑、硬件配置、软件编程及调试步骤,帮助读者掌握三菱PLC在工业自动化称重系统中的应用,文章将涵盖从基础概念到实践操作的全方位指导,确保读者能够独立完成称重重量累加程序的编写与调试。
在工业自动化领域,称重系统扮演着至关重要的角色,三菱PLC作为工业控制领域的佼佼者,其强大的逻辑控制能力和灵活的编程环境使其成为实现称重重量累加功能的理想选择,本文将围绕三菱PLC的称重重量累加程序展开,从硬件配置到软件编程,全面解析实现过程。
硬件配置
1、称重传感器选择
称重传感器是将物体的重量转换为电信号的关键部件,在选择称重传感器时,需考虑其精度、量程、输出信号类型(如模拟量或数字量)等因素,对于三菱PLC,通常选择模拟量输出的称重传感器,以便与PLC的模拟量输入模块相连。
2、PLC选型与模块配置
根据称重系统的需求,选择合适的三菱PLC型号及扩展模块,对于需要处理模拟量信号的称重系统,应选用带有模拟量输入(AI)模块的PLC,考虑系统的扩展性和未来可能的升级需求,选择具有足够I/O点数和通信能力的PLC。
3、接线与调试
将称重传感器的输出信号接入PLC的模拟量输入模块,注意信号的极性、量程匹配及屏蔽处理,完成接线后,进行初步调试,确保信号传输无误。
软件编程
1、程序逻辑设计
在编写程序前,首先明确称重重量累加的功能需求,需要实时显示当前重量、累计重量、设置重量阈值等,根据功能需求,设计程序逻辑框架,包括数据初始化、重量采集、累加计算、报警处理等模块。
2、梯形图编程
使用三菱PLC的编程软件(如GX Developer或GX Works3)进行梯形图编程,以下是一个简单的称重重量累加程序的梯形图示例:
初始化模块:设置初始值,如累计重量为0。
重量采集模块:读取称重传感器的模拟量信号,通过A/D转换得到实际重量值。
累加计算模块:将当前重量值累加到累计重量中。
报警处理模块:当累计重量达到或超过设定的阈值时,触发报警输出。
在梯形图中,使用比较指令、加法指令、移位指令等实现上述功能。
3、数据处理与显示
对于采集到的重量数据,可能需要进行滤波处理以消除噪声干扰,将处理后的数据通过PLC的通信接口(如RS-485、以太网等)传输至上位机或触摸屏进行显示和监控。
调试与优化
1、模拟测试
在正式投入运行前,进行模拟测试以验证程序的正确性,可以使用信号发生器模拟称重传感器的输出信号,观察PLC的响应是否符合预期。
2、现场调试
将PLC及称重系统安装到现场后,进行实际运行调试,注意检查接线是否牢固、信号传输是否稳定、程序逻辑是否正确执行等。
3、优化与改进
根据现场调试结果,对程序进行优化和改进,调整滤波参数以提高数据准确性、优化报警处理逻辑以减少误报等。
案例分析
以下是一个基于三菱PLC的称重重量累加程序的案例分析:
某工厂生产线上的物料称重系统,要求实时显示物料重量、累计重量,并在累计重量达到1000kg时触发报警,通过选用三菱FX3U系列PLC及模拟量输入模块,结合GX Works3编程软件,实现了上述功能,在程序中,通过A/D转换指令读取称重传感器的模拟量信号,使用加法指令实现重量累加,通过比较指令判断累计重量是否达到阈值,并触发报警输出,经过现场调试和优化,该系统运行稳定可靠,满足了生产需求。
三菱PLC在工业自动化称重系统中的应用具有显著优势,通过合理的硬件配置和软件编程,可以轻松实现称重重量累加功能,本文详细介绍了三菱PLC称重重量累加程序的编写过程,包括硬件配置、软件编程、调试与优化等方面,希望本文能为读者提供有益的参考和借鉴,助力工业自动化领域的创新与发展。